with Nassim AbiGhanem
This work addresses the broad question: why are some bottom-up peace initiatives successful, while others are not? Looking at the case of Tunisia post-Arab Spring, this research identifies the extent to which social capital and brokerage can contribute to sustainable and successful initiatives by utilizing social network analysis as a conceptual and methodological approach.This lecture is open to faculty and staff. It is presented by Dr. Nassim AbiGhanem, director of the Politics Concentration at BCB, as part of the Faculty Colloquium series, organized by Gale Raj-Reichert, Ewa Atanassow, and Nina Tecklenburg.
